Osteoporosis
A bone disease characterized by decreased bone density and strength, resulting in fragile bones and an increased risk of fractures.
Neurons
Nerve cells that transmit information through electrical and chemical signals; they are the fundamental units of the brain and nervous system.
Sensory Receptors
Biological structures designed to detect changes in the environment, such as touch, temperature, or light, and transmit this information to the nervous system.
Muscle Strength
The maximum amount of force a muscle or group of muscles can exert against an external load.
